Masamichi Hosoda submitted the
extractpdfmark
package.
Version: 1.0.0
License: gpl3
Summary description: Extract page mode and named destinations as PDFmark from PDF
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
If you create a PDF document by something like TeX systems, many small
PDFs as figures get included into the main PDF. It is common for each
small PDF to use the same fonts.
If the small PDFs are embedded subsetted fonts, the TeX system includes
them as-is for the main PDF. As a result, the main PDF is embedded
different subsets of the same duplicate font. It is not possible to
remove the duplicates since they are different subsets. It enormously
increases the main PDF file size.
On the other hand, if the small PDFs are embedded full set fonts,
the TeX system also includes all of them for the main PDF.
The main PDF is embedded many duplicate fonts, but they are
all same full set fonts. Therefore, Ghostscript can remove
the duplicates. It can reduce the main PDF files size.
Moreover, if the small PDFs are not embedded any fonts, the
TeX system outputs the main PDF which lacks some fonts.
In this case, Ghostscript can embed the necessary fonts.
It can significantly reduce the required disk size.
Either way, Ghostscript inputs the main PDF which is outputted
by the TeX system, and outputs the final PDF. Unfortunately,
during this process, Ghostscript does not preserve PDF page-mode
and named-destinations etc. As a result, when you open the final
PDF, it cannot realize the intended how the document shall be
displayed. Remote PDF links also do not work.
Extract PDFmark can extract page mode and named destinations as
PDFmark from PDF. You can get the small PDF that has preserved
them by using this tool.

Cameron Gray submitted the
bangorexam
package.
Version number: 1.0.0
License type: lppl1.3
Summary description: Typeset an examination at Bangor University
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Version 1.0.0 allows typesetting of Bangor University's Section A/B
exam style. The 'two from four' type will be added in a later
version. Marks are totalled and checked automatically.

Nicola Talbot submitted an update to the
tracklang
package.
Version number: 1.3 2016-10-08
License type: lppl1.3
Summary description: Language and dialect tracker
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
v1.3 (2016-10-08):
* New files tracklang-scripts.tex, tracklang-scripts.sty
tracklang-region-codes.tex
* tracklang.tex:
- Now sets and restores category code for @ if it's not initially 11
(no change if it's already 11)
- New command TrackLocale{POSIX locale}
and TrackLanguageTag{BCP47 language tag}
- New command TrackLangFromEnv. (Queries locale environment
variable using TrackLangQueryEnv and, if successful,
then parses and tracks the dialect. Also sets
TrackLangEnvLang, TrackLangEnvTerritory,
TrackLangEnvCodeSet and TrackLangEnvModifier.)
- New command TrackLangQueryEnv (queries the environment
variables LC_ALL or LANG, if shell escape or directlua
available, and sets TrackLangEnv)
- New command TrackLangQueryOtherEnv (like the above
but queries an extra environment variable)
- New command TrackLangParseFromEnv (parses TrackLangEnv,
if defined and not empty, and sets TrackLangEnvLang,
TrackLangEnvTerritory, TrackLangEnvCodeSet and
TrackLangEnvModifier)
- Many other new commands. See Changes section of manual.
- New language and dialect options
- Bug fix: corrected ISO 639-1 language code in usorbian
